SUBJECT: IRELAND: BELARUS RESOLUTION AT THE UNCHR 
 
REF: STATE 41971 
 
On March 10, Emboff delivered reftel draft resolution to Leah 
Hoctor, Human Rights Desk Officer at the Department of 
Foreign Affairs.  Hoctor said that upon initial review of the 
draft of the Belarus Resolution, the staff of the Human 
Rights section has no areas of concern and is following the 
EU lead on this issue.  She said she will circulate the draft 
and discuss it with EU colleagues, but offers no comments or 
changes at this time.
